jriv86: If your having problems on defense its probably due to play calling. Do you use a lot of man 2 man d where only 1 person is assigned to rb? if so this doesn't work very well because if one man misses his assignment it could result in a big play. I tend to mix it up a lot. I like to use zone blitz. I also blitz from a mixture of safety and cbs. The key with the set is to not be predictable. The CPU is very smart on this set and if you continuously call similar plays they will eat you alive. If you were to adjust anything I would


FairCatchMania: Try making these adjustments
QB Accuracy 13, User Tackle 23 I think this will drastically improve any problems you have.

Ok Im finally able to post a thread today! So here is the much anticipated Slider set that I have developed over the past month. I have done a lot of research and weeks of testing to perfect these sliders.


First of all these sliders are mostly aimed for people who want realistic stats and still be challenged and actually if they make poor decisions and call vanilla defensive or offensive plays. This set will push your play calling and team building skills to the max. You will always have a different experience with these sliders. Players attributes, confidence, and home games actually effect gameplay the way they would in real life. No more cpu qbs afraid to take a shot down the field or throw the ball away. All the issues people are having with this years madden 15 are solved with these sliders. These also give a good mix of RB1/RB2 Snaps. Just try them out and let me know what your experience is.


Please note that if you get frustrated easily because you don't win every game and don't like realistic and strategic gameplay then these sliders are not for you.


I have a new set and have played over 20 games with it Please Try it out and let me know what you think! Stats and screenshots coming very soon!


(Post Patch Updates in RED)
(Advanced All Madden Sliders)

All Madden
13 Minute Quarters
13 Minimum Play clock
Slow

User
Accuracy 13 (3)
Pass Block 23(13)
WR Catch 33
Run Block 3
Fumbles 23 (13)
Pass Reaction 93
Pass Coverage 3
Interceptions 93
Tackling 3

CPU
QB Acc 3 (23)
Pass Blk 83 (93)
WR Catch 43
Run Block 63
Fumbles 33
Reaction Time 93
Interception 33 (43)
Pass Coverage 3
Tackling 93

Special Teams
All on 53

Game Options
Injuries 43
Fatigue 73
Threshold 3

Penalty (very important)
Offside 73
False Start 83
Holding 3
Facemask 53
Defense Interference 93
Offense Interference 3
Punt Catch 53
Clipping 53
Intentional Grounding 3
Roughing Passer 53
Roughing Kicker 53

Auto Subs
QB 13/3
RB 95/93
WR 63/53
TE/FB 63/53
OL 13/3
All Defense 73/63
